Table 5-12. OSPF Areas Setup

Parameters

Possible Values

Description

 

 

 

Area

0.0.0.0. to

 

 

255.255.255.255

 

 

 

 

Type

Normal

Accepts all types of OSPF traffic (Standard Area)

 

Stub

Accepts all types of OSPF traffic, except

 

 

AS-external-LSA’s (type 5 LSAs)

 

NSSA

Not-So-Stubby-Area – a stub area that connects

 

 

to an external AS

 

 

 

OSPF Summaries Setup

To reduce the number of LSAs advertised, it’s common practice in OSPF to configure IP subnets in contiguous manner and to define subnet summarization. It means that the area border router will try to aggregate various subnets it learned in one area before advertising it in another area.
